| Metric | $23,976 | $84,276 |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Gross Salary | $23,976 | $84,276 | $60,300 |
| Federal Tax | $898 | $10,155 | $9,257 |
| State Tax | $0 | $0 | $0 |
| FICA (SS + Medicare) | $1,834 | $6,447 | $4,613 |
| Take-Home Pay (Yearly) | $21,244 | $67,674 | $46,430 |
| Take-Home (Monthly) | $1,770 | $5,640 | $3,869 |
| Effective Tax Rate | 11.4% | 19.7% | 8.3% |

Tax Bracket Change: This salary increase crosses from the 10% Bracket into the 22% Bracket. Only the income above the threshold is taxed at the higher rate - you won't lose money by earning more.
State Tax Varies: These calculations use Texas (0% state tax). In California, you'd pay an additional ~6-9% state tax. In New York, add ~5-8%. Florida, Texas, Washington, and Nevada have no state income tax.
